News

The Liberals are projected to win more of Parliament’s 343 seats than the Conservatives, though it wasn’t clear yet if they ...
The collapse of Canada’s minor parties accounts for some of this local-level volatility. The left-wing New Democratic Party ...
Pierre Poilievre lost the vote for a constituency he has held for 21 years to a Liberal political neophyte. His populist ...
Conservative Leader Pierre Poilievre is projected to lose his own seat in the Canadian election, despite delivering the best ...
Poilievre losing his own seat capped off a devastating night for Canada's conservatives as they were decisively beaten in the ...
In Brampton, a city known for its strong Punjabi presence, the election results were particularly noteworthy. Five ...